Rendu de graphiques dans les PDFs

Lors du chargement de graphiques à l'aide de JavaScript, il est important de prévoir suffisamment de temps pour l'exécution de JavaScript. Ci-dessous un exemple montrant comment configurer ce processus :

Dans le code ci-dessus, nous avons activé l'exécution de JavaScript à l'aide de la propriété enableJavaScript. La propriété waitFor est utilisée pour retarder le processus de rendu et attendre l'exécution de JavaScript. Cette configuration spécifique, utilisant WaitForType.JavaScript, attendra que la fonction window.ironpdf.notifyRender soit appelée dans le script ou que le délai d'attente maximal soit atteint.

De plus, l'option multimédia CSS garantira que l'affichage et la mise en page du contenu HTML respectent les paramètres d'écran.

Explorer l'exemple JS Charts to PDF sur GitHub

Prêt à commencer?
Version : 2026.5 just released
Still Scrolling Icon

Vous faites encore défiler ?

Vous voulez une preuve rapidement ?
exécuter un échantillon Regardez votre code HTML se transformer en PDF.